A broken, leaking roof is among the most feared home repairs because discovering and fixing a leak isn’t generally straightforward.

Stained or drooping sheetrock, flaking paint, or an evident drip are all signs of a roof leak. Nevertheless, even a minor undiscovered leak can trigger damaged insulation, mildew development, and decomposed wood structure. A leak can also move and spread from the original broken region to another part of your property.

Most of roof leakages in Somerset, New Jersey are caused by reasonably typical situations that damage your roof.

  • Your roof will never have a bad day, yet aging is unavoidable. All roofing products are prone to extreme weather such as rainstorms, freeze/thaw cycles, high temperatures, and intense summer season sun, which may eventually trigger early aging, splitting, and curling of the shingles.
  • Brick chimneys appear to be strong, however the mortar that holds the bricks together, in addition to the flashing and chimney crown, can be readily destroyed. Water may get into the attic through fractures, corrosion, and leaks.
  • A leak can be easily brought on by missing out on or broken shingles. Individual shingle replacement is generally not a major issue, but stopping working to get it fixed may lead to more broken shingles and more expensive repairs.
  • The vents on your roof system consist of exposed fasteners that will fracture, degrade, and age in time. This is a little repair, however it is a common source of leakages since a lot of vents do not last the life of the roof.
  • The pipes boot slips over a pipe to protect the pipe’s connection to the roof. The boot, like the vents and flashing, can be harmed, fracture, and fail. The repair isn’t especially hard, although damage can be quickly overlooked.
  • Storm damage, strong winds, and hail might all trigger big and small holes. Some holes are evident, but others may go undiscovered for several years till an evaluation reveals them. Water can go into through even small holes triggered by misplaced roofing nails, the removal of an antenna or dish installing bracket, or impact-related fissures in roofing materials.
  • A complex, complicated roofline might be rather enticing, however it is also harder to water resistant. Every joint, valley, and slope must be marked.
  • Roof products battle to hold up against freeze-thaw cycles, in addition to ice and snow. Water might sneak into tiny spaces between and under shingles when snow builds up, melts, and refreezes. Water swells and deepens the fracture as it freezes. The weight of the snow and ice can likewise cause bending and sagging of the flashing and plywood foundation.
  • Seamless gutters might posture difficulties if they are not cleaned and fixed on a regular basis. Rainwater can support behind a blockage and penetrate through the shingles, harming the wood below. Standing water can also trigger harm to older seamless gutters.
  • Skylights, like chimneys and pipe vents, have a few of the exact same problems. Aside from potential flashing damage, the rubber or vinyl seals around skylights may dry up and fracture; at this point, the skylight needs to be replaced.
  • Wetness can develop in your attic as a result of ventilation issues, and this can imitate a roof leak. In order to adequately evacuate warm air and wetness from your attic area, your roof should have sufficient consumption and exhaust ventilation. This can lead to wood rot, mold, and damaged insulation, and it has the possible to be a very expensive repair.

The greatest protection against roof leaks is to schedule a yearly roof inspection and to act quickly if you suspect a leak.
